The Basics • A concept map is a way to graphically represent relationships between ideas, images, or words • Helps to generate ideas and creativity • Concepts are represented in boxes or circles • Concepts are connected with linking phrases • Different than a Mind Map
How to Concept Map • Start with the major idea at the top of the page; • Shift down the page from more complex, to less complex ideas; • Connecting phrases must link each idea; • Cross links can be made between concepts, or across the page; • Examples may be added.
The Process • Brainstorm individually and in a group the main ideas of a concept; • Write these ideas down on paper, or if available, post-it notes; • Sort and classify the ideas, looking for relationships; • Transfer the ideas onto a large sheet of paper; • Draw lines and inserting linking words or phrases; • Look for additional relationships between concepts.
